After his recent comment before the South Africa ODIs, rumours of Virat Kohli possible Test comeback spread like wildfire. His statement gave new life to those fans who thought that he might take back his retirement. The speculation escalated substantially after he scored a magnificent 135 in Ranchi to kick off the series.
Rumours Rise After Kohliโs Comment
Kohli decided to quit Test cricket in May, a choice that left his fans very much surprised and disappointed. His statement about continuing to play cricket with full passion at any level was what made the fans’ sudden hope so evident. The talk was all over social media with people associating his strong ODI performance with a return to the field. Many fanatics of his game thought that his intensity and fitness were just signs of an eventual tearful reversal, and the debate kept going till late at night as enthusiasm rose exponentially on the net.
BCCI Clarifies as Virat Kohli Ends Speculation
Theโโโโโโโโโโโโโโโโ noise in the scene was removed by BCCI secretary Devajit Saikia who went on to contradict every rumour of talks with Virat Kohli. He said that there were no talks and people should not spreading rumors. After the first ODI, Kohli ending the speculation, and stating explicitly that he is only one format.
He mentioned that he is really concentrating on India’s white-ball fixtures and that is why he is the one who took the decision and kept โโโโโโโโโโโโโโโโit. His clarity calmed many fans who had been waiting eagerly for an unexpected twist in the situation.
